我的Odoo用户可以访问两家公司,但是当我运行以下代码(使用here中所述的ripcord)时,它仅向我显示默认公司的数据:
$domain = [];
$domain[] = ['year', '=', '2019'];
$fields = ['account_id', 'date', 'balance2'];
$groupby = ['account_id', 'date'];
$result = $models->execute_kw($a, $b, $c, 'account.budget.report', 'read_group', [$domain, $fields, $groupby], []);
将['company_id', '=', '31']
添加到数组$domain
无效。
如何更改当前要与之合作的公司?
答案 0 :(得分:1)
自己弄清楚。在查看浏览器如何更改公司之前,我首先需要执行以下write
操作:
$result = $models->execute_kw($a, $b, $c, 'res.users', 'write', [[75], ['company_id' => 31]]);
75是我的用户ID。